KinoPoisk, KinoPoisk.Ru (Russian: КиноПоиск, КиноПоиск.Ru, Кино is movie and Поиск is search) is a Russian website about cinematography. The site provides information about movies, TV shows, actors, directors, producers, screenwriters, composers, editors etc. It also has some features of social networks. At the moment it is one of the most popular movie portals of Runet,[2][3] it occupies the 18th line in Alexa rating of Russian websites as of July 2016.[1] It was often compared to IMDb.

In 2013, Kinopoisk was purchased by Yandex, one of Russia's largest IT companies. In 2015, Kinopoisk underwent a total redesign. However, the new design was met with strong criticism by both users and the media for its inferior functionality and slower loading time. Within four days Yandex reverted the site to its former design that remains in use to this day. At approximately the same time Kinopoisk introduced an online cinema theater feature, providing some of the movies for free and reserving others for subscribers.
